Through fields and meadows, past horse paddocks and along streams, the Schindauweg offers insights into the mill history of Neuhofen and Euratsfeld.
Popis
The predominantly flat circular hiking route leads along field and bike paths through the recreational areas Schindau and Karling and runs south along the Amstetten town boundary along the Zauchbach and east along the Gafringbach.

Popis trasy Schindauweg No. 227
From the market square, we march along the main road to the fire station in Wassergasse, where at the crossing we turn right, a short stretch towards Amstetten, then left through Gewerbegasse down into the mill fields and into the Schindau. First over a concrete bridge and then a stone bridge, we leave Schindau heading south and cross the main road to then walk over the bridge up to the Edelmühle near Zederleiten. At the hunter’s chapel, we turn right and continue marching through the forest to Damberg. From there, it goes down to the main road LH 90 and on the bike and pedestrian path over Pichl roundabout into Haslau (mill) and further to Auberg. Now we walk near the Gafringbach through Karling northwards back to Euratsfeld. From the Stockschützenplatz, the route leads up the street via Bunnenweg into the town center to the starting point.

Tip autora
The Waidahammer chapel is easily accessible by a short detour of a few minutes. At the Pichl roundabout, near the Datzberger farmhouse, there is the mill educational trail, which describes in detail the traditional craft of millers and the 11 historic mills on the Zauch. Guided tours of the Haslawmill can be booked in advance at the municipal office.
